What is National DMV Appreciation Month? National DMV Appreciation Month occurs in September each year and is a time for the Donate Life Community to say thank you and show its appreciation of DMV partners across the country through national and local events and outreach. Thousands Celebrate Life at the 24th Annual Donor Dash
On Sunday, July 16th, 2023, in Denver’s Washington Park, thousands gathered to celebrate life at the 24th Annual Donor Dash 5k! Exciting Events at the Transplant Games of America
The Donate Life Transplant Games of America were held in San Diego, CA on July 29-August 3, 2022. This event occurs every two years and brings together people all around the nation who have been a connection to organ, eye and tissue donation and transplantation.
